Foodzilla stands out with live coaching integrations, letting trainers adjust meal plans during client video calls. Its branded reports detail micronutrient levels – crucial for athletes managing performance nutrition. One user notes: “The vitamin tracking helped identify a client’s iron deficiency we’d missed for months.”
NutriAdmin streamlines communication through automated progress surveys paired with recipe suggestions. Coaches can build custom plans in 15 minutes using its drag-and-drop interface. Meanwhile, WeStrive merges workout scheduling with dietary tracking, syncing exercise intensity with calorie targets automatically.
While MyFitnessPal’s 14-million-item database appeals to general users, Nutritics caters to specialists with supplement analysis and commercial kitchen integrations. Dietmaster Pro simplifies label creation for trainers developing branded food products – a growing niche in the wellness market.
UK-based Nutrium reduces client dropout through habit-tracking features that celebrate small dietary wins. Its platform sends automatic encouragement messages when users log vegetable intake or water consumption, fostering lasting behavior changes.

Tips for Selecting the Right Nutrition Software for Your Business
Choosing tools that grow with your practice requires strategic evaluation. The best platforms act as force multipliers, addressing immediate needs while adapting to future ambitions. Focus on solutions that simplify complexity rather than adding it.
Essential Considerations and Customization Options
Start by comparing pricing models against client capacity limits. Scalable platforms let you manage multiple clients without sudden cost spikes. Look for white-label options that mirror your brand’s visual identity – crucial for maintaining professional consistency.
Database depth determines real-world usability. Platforms with 500,000+ verified food items reduce client frustration during logging. Prebuilt templates for common fitness goals save hours while ensuring scientific accuracy.
Aligning Software Capabilities With Business Goals
Assess whether features match your target audience’s needs. Specialized athletes require different tracking than general wellness clients. Prioritize systems that centralize communication, progress reports, and scheduling in one place.
Test-drive interfaces with actual users before committing. Tools that confuse clients undermine adherence rates. One studio owner noted: “Switching to intuitive software cut our onboarding time by half while improving compliance.”
